The FeeForge rules engine, which computes shipping fees for Marlowe Mercantile checkouts, is intermittently failing to reach its rules database since the 14:20 deploy. Symptoms: pool acquisition timeouts every few minutes, fee evaluation falling back to cached rules. Restarting the service clears it for roughly an hour. Suspect a leaked connection in the new tier-lookup path. On-call: please enable pool tracing and capture a leak report. Use the staging database via the connection string below.

replica DSN, kagaf-kajef: postgresql://eliius_svc:UA@db-a408.paliqnet.internal:5432/istys

## Changelog — Pilewatch Autoscaler v5.1

The setting `AUTOSCALE_KEY` has been renamed to `PILEWATCH_BROKER_SECRET` to clarify that it authenticates against the Dunmore queue broker, not the scaling API. The old name is no longer read as of this release, so on-call should update the env file during the next restart window. Add the renamed variable on the line below:

sealed setting: ARCHIVE_KEY3=8d0

## Runbook: Faremark rules engine — shipping fee incidents

Faremark evaluates shipping-fee rules for all Cartington checkouts. If fees come back as zero or wildly high, first check rule compilation status; a failed compile silently falls back to the previous ruleset. Restarting the evaluator is safe and takes under ten seconds. Do not edit rules directly in prod — route changes through the staging promoter. The evaluator starts with the configuration below.

service settings:
PRAIX_LOG_LEVEL=error
PRAIX_METRICS_HOST=metrics.praix.qorvelcorp.corp
PRAIX_POOL_SIZE=16

## Data Stores: Alertmux Deduplicator

Alertmux collapses duplicate on-call pages within a 90-second window. Dedup keys are hashed alert fingerprints stored in the `dedup_ring` table; no payload bodies are retained. Retention is 72 hours, enforced by a nightly purge job. Access is limited to the pager-dispatch service account. For audit purposes, the reviewer should verify grants against the primary store, reachable via the following connection string.

primary connection of yagep-kahip = redis://giliel_svc:zYiKsLL2PLpfPL@db-348f.xolmarsys.corp:5432/fenwyn